It’s tough to know what to make of the new-look Oakland Raiders (5-4), but we should get a better idea of how good or bad they really are in Sunday’s 1:00 PM ET showdown against the Minnesota Vikings.
The Raiders opened up as a 3-point road favorite but the odds were quickly bet down to a pick ‘em.
The opening total of 44 has also seen some change and is currently at 45.5.
Close to 70% of tracked NFL bettors are taking Oakland to cover the point spread, but that hasn’t stopped the line from moving big in the other direction.
Those betting on this game in Las Vegas have a wide variety of options to choose from. Although most online sportsbooks have the game as a pick, the Las Vegas Hilton still has the Oakland Raiders at +1.5 while the MGM Mirage is showing +1.
The total sits at 45 at Leroy’s for those that want the over, and at 46 at Wynn for those that are leaning toward betting the under.
The Raiders are +105 on the money line at the Las Vegas Hilton, while Minnesota is returning -125.
Oakland and Minnesota have met up just twice since the 2003 season, and each time managed to grab a home win.
The Raiders won 28-18 as 4.5-point underdogs in Oakland in 2003, while Minnesota returned the favor with a 29-22 home win as 4.5-point favorites in 2007.
The over was a winner in both of the games after 3 straight head-to-head meetings from 1993-to-1999 all went under.
The Raiders lost by double digits to the Kansas City Chiefs and the Denver Broncos in home games after starting Carson Palmer at quarterback, but they rebounded to win 24-17 at the San Diego Chargers last weekend.
It remains to be seen if the win is a sign of good things to come for Oakland.
